~ chicken-core (chicken-5) 0f55d5a15763a1d0dc0fe1900f6a2686454729c4
commit 0f55d5a15763a1d0dc0fe1900f6a2686454729c4
Author: Evan Hanson <evhan@foldling.org>
AuthorDate: Fri Jul 10 12:30:21 2015 +1200
Commit: Evan Hanson <evhan@foldling.org>
CommitDate: Fri Jul 10 12:30:21 2015 +1200
Remove unused ##sys#abort-load procedure
diff --git a/eval.scm b/eval.scm
index aadb0136..b5bb76da 100644
--- a/eval.scm
+++ b/eval.scm
@@ -937,7 +937,6 @@
(define load-verbose (make-parameter (##sys#fudge 13)))
-(define (##sys#abort-load) #f)
(define ##sys#current-source-filename #f)
(define ##sys#current-load-path "")
(define ##sys#dload-disabled #f)
@@ -1016,8 +1015,7 @@
(##sys#current-load-path
(and fname
(let ((i (has-sep? fname)))
- (if i (##sys#substring fname 0 (fx+ i 1)) ""))))
- (##sys#abort-load (lambda () (abrt #f))))
+ (if i (##sys#substring fname 0 (fx+ i 1)) "")))))
(let ((in (if fname (open-input-file fname) input)))
(##sys#dynamic-wind
(lambda () #f)
Trap